Falling Limbs and Storm Damage

Anyone who’s experienced a storm knows how unpredictable weather can be. High winds and heavy rain can turn weak branches or unstable trees into flying projectiles. Dead or damaged limbs that might seem harmless on calm days can break off suddenly, endangering people, vehicles, roofs, fences — you name it. Professional assessment helps identify these risky limbs before they become dangerous. Unseen Structural Weakness

Just because a tree looks healthy from afar doesn’t mean it’s structurally sound. Internal decay, root rot, or hidden disease can compromise a tree’s stability, making collapse more likely during storms or even regular weather fluctuations. These conditions are often invisible to the untrained eye, yet they can have serious consequences if left untreated.

Roots and Hidden Hazards

Tree roots can spread far beyond the canopy and create unseen problems: cracking sidewalks, upheaving driveways, even threatening foundations. These issues may not show symptoms until it’s too late, leading to expensive repair bills down the line. Professional inspections catch these risks early.

Thorough Inspection and Risk Assessment

Professional tree care starts with a comprehensive evaluation. Arborists don’t just look at what’s visible — they assess the health, structure, and stability of every tree. This includes checking for:

  • Signs of disease or decay

  • Cracks or splits in the trunk

  • Weak branch unions

  • Root problems

  • Leaning patterns or storm stress

This kind of evaluation can’t be replicated with a quick glance or a DIY YouTube tutorial — it comes from training, experience, and a deep understanding of tree biology. 

Strategic Pruning and Trimming

Removing dead or weak limbs isn’t just about looks — it’s about reducing risk. Professional pruning shapes the tree and removes hazards without harming the tree’s long-term health. Proper pruning techniques help trees withstand storms and reduce the likelihood of falling branches that can injure people or damage structures. 

Safe Tree Removal When Necessary

Sometimes the best solution is to remove a tree entirely — especially when it’s diseased, unstable, or too close to a home or utility lines. Professional crews use specialized equipment and methods to dismantle trees safely — piece by piece — protecting surrounding structures and preventing accidents.

Safety Tips Every Homeowner Should Know

While professional care is the best long-term strategy, here are some quick safety practices:

  • Don’t climb trees with a chainsaw — this is a leading cause of serious injury.

  • Keep trees trimmed away from power lines — never work near electrical lines without professionals.

  • Schedule seasonal inspections — especially before storm seasons.

  • Address decay or rot immediately — early intervention prevents bigger hazards.

These simple steps combined with professional care help keep your property safe.
